The Importance of Franchise Income in IPL Success

There was a revenue model set in place for the first eight franchise owners latest by sixth year because there was a chunk of revenue assured in form of broadcast rights. By the end of the sixth season every franchise was bound to break even that was the whole trucks of IPL success. Cupboard knee also had a mass following more importantly just like cricket. The best quality in that particular sport is on display in cupboard knee. This is where the other franchise based league lacks severely both in terms of quality not it's not the top quality sport nor does it have mass following. So there is very little revenue in terms of broadcast right. Then how will a franchise investor or franchise owner earn money?
